It’s time for pantomime again, with Leighton Buzzard Drama Group’s production of Treasure Island – starting on January 9 with a Relaxed Performance (primarily for a SEND audience) followed by 14 regular shows from January 10 to January 25.

Shows are on Thursday evenings, Friday evenings and three on each Saturday.

The HMS Hispaniola with its band of pirates travels the high seas searching for hidden treasure. Audiences will meet Hettie Hawkins, the pub landlady, and her son Jim who is secretly in love with Suzie, while they pit their wits against the evilest pirate ever, Black Dog, and the useless Roger and Dodger.

And what do Blind Pew, Ben Gunn, Long John Sillier and Captain Jack Swallow get up to? Better go along and see! Will there be laughs a plenty? Oh yes. Will there be songs to sing along with? Indeed! Will they find the treasure? Only one way to find out!

Director Caroline Page said: “We have worked hard to put everything into this panto: great characters, lots of comedy, fantastic musical numbers, and a super script by Jim Fowler. There should be something for everyone!”.
